2024-22824. Notice of Public Meeting for the National Park System Advisory Board  

  • AGENCY:

    National Park Service, Interior.

    ACTION:

    Meeting notice.

    SUMMARY:

    In accordance with the Federal Advisory Committee Act of 1972, as amended, the National Park Service (NPS) is hereby giving notice that the National Park System Advisory Board (Board) will meet as noted below.

    DATES:

    The Board will hold public meetings on Monday, December 9, 2024, from 11:00 a.m. until 5:30 p.m. (eastern) and Tuesday, December 10, 2024, from 11:00 a.m. until 5:30 p.m. (eastern). Individuals that wish to participate must contact the person listed in the F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T section no later than Monday, December 2, 2024, to receive instructions for accessing the meeting. The meeting will be held online through the Teams platform and is open to the public.

    S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

    The Board has been established by authority of the Secretary of the Interior (Secretary) under 54 U.S.C. 100906 and is regulated by the Federal Advisory Committee Act.

    Purpose of the Meeting: The Board will be briefed by NPS officials on the organization, programs, and priorities of the NPS, and will attend to housekeeping matters, including the potential establishment of committees and committee recommendations. The Board will also receive NHL and NNL proposals for Board deliberation. There will be an opportunity for public comment. The final agenda and briefing materials will be posted to the Board's website prior to the meeting at https://www.nps.gov/​resources/​advisoryboard150.htm.

    The agenda may include the review of proposed actions regarding the NHL Program and the NNL Program. Interested parties are encouraged to submit written comments and recommendations that will be presented to the Board. Interested parties also may attend the Board meeting virtually and upon request may address the Board concerning an area's national significance.

    A. National Historic Landmarks (NHL) Program

    NHL Program matters will be considered, during which the Board may consider the following:

    Nominations for NHL Designation

    California

    • TOR HOUSE (ROBINSON JEFFERS HOME), Carmel, CA
    • SUMMIT CAMP, Placer and Nevada Cos., CA

    Colorado

    • BOULDER COUNTY COURTHOUSE, Boulder, CO

    District of Columbia

    • LUCY DIGGS SLOWE AND MARY BURRILL HOUSE, Washington, DC

    District of Guam

    • MANENGGON CONCENTRATION CAMP, Yona, GU

    Iowa

    • REEVE REA POWER GENERATING PLANT, Hampton, IA

    Louisiana

    MR. CHARLIE OFFSHORE OILRIG, Morgan City, LA

    New Hampshire

    • LUCKNOW (CASTLE IN THE CLOUDS), Moultonborough, NH

    New Mexico

    • PETER HURD AND HENRIETTE WYETH HOUSE AND STUDIOS, San Patricio, NM

    New York

    • WINGED FOOT GOLF COURSE, Mamaroneck, NY

    North Carolina

    F.W. WOOLWORTH CO. BUILDING, Greensboro, NC ( print page 80601)

    North Carolina and Virginia

    • BLUE RIDGE PARKWAY, multiple, NC and VA

    Virginia

    • LOUDOUN COUNTY COURTHOUSE, Leesburg, VA
    • AZUREST SOUTH, Petersburg, VA

    Proposed Amendments to Existing NHL Designations

    Alaska

    • FORT WILLIAM H. SEWARD (updated documentation), Haines, AK

    Maryland

    • MONOCACY BATTLEFIELD (updated documentation, boundary change), Frederick, MD

    Pennsylvania

    • CARRIE BLAST FURNACES NUMBER 6 AND 7 (updated documentation, boundary change), multiple, Alleghany County, PA

    Virginia

    • FORT MONROE (updated documentation), Hampton, VA

    Washington

    • FORT WORDEN (updated documentation), Port Townsend, WA

    Proposed Withdrawal of Existing Designations:

    Hawai'i

    FALLS OF CLYDE (FOUR-MASTED OIL TANKER), Honolulu, HI

    B. National Natural Landmarks (NNL) Program

    NNL Program matters will be considered, during which the Board may consider the following:

    Nomination for NNL Designation

    Massachusetts

    • NANTUCKET BARRIER BEACH AND WILDLIFE REFUGE, Nantucket County, MA
